Charlottesville Regional Chamber of Commerce Launches Business News Web Log on cvillechamber.com
(Charlottesville, Virginia - March 12) The Charlottesville Regional Chamber of Commerce today announced the launching of its new business news web log, "Business Today," on the Chamber's web site, cvillechamber.com. The "Business Today" web log, or "BLOG," as they are commonly known, will allow the Chamber to publish member enterprise news immediately, as it is received. This will raise awareness and visibility of the activities of Chamber member enterprises, and add value to the Chamber's web site, cvillechamber.com.
"Over the course of the past couple years, as we have undergone our Chamber's 21st Century Strategic Initiative, our members have often requested more and better ways to get their business news noticed," said Ivo Romenesko, President of Appraisal Group Inc., who serves as 2004 Chairman of the Chamber Board of Directors. "Our new web log gives immediate access to our member business news -- to the full Internet audience and more importantly to the 13,000+ visitors utilizing our Chamber's site on a monthly basis."

Members of the media are encouraged to use the Chamber's "Business Today" web log as a resource for area business news. The Chamber's news log was developed utilizing Internet based technology from "Blogger.com."
Along with the new "Business Today" web log, the Chamber will continue to produce its regular schedule of business publications: "Chamber Comments," our Chamber's bi-monthly newsletter, and "Chamber Bits," our weekly email e-briefing on business news and business happenings. The Charlottesville Regional Chamber of Commerce is dedicated to representing private enterprise, promoting business and enhancing the quality of life in our greater Charlottesville communities. The Chamber 's more than 1,200 member businesses and civic organizations employ more than 45,000 people in our community, generating a total payroll of more than $1.3 billion each year.
